Genuine wheelboxes are cheap and easily available - they would be my vote after poor experiences with aftermarket ones.

The later (2002-on) wheelboxes with the threaded spindles have a different sized gear and so the sweep will be different, if fitting to an older vehicle you will need to update the crank gear in the wiper motor at the same time to maintain the swept range of the arms. The rest of the motor is the same.

The earlier motor does actually run slower than the later type motor- If you use the later wheelboxes on an earlier motor and update the crankgear, the wiper speed is slower than a newer motor - my Puma 90 slow speed setting is almost as fast as my updated 300tdis fast setting.
